Carrara and the marble civilization. The ancient Romans discovered 2,000 years ago the presence of this white and shiny stone in the mountains we now call the Apuan Alps. Rome, the imperial capital, was rebuilt using the white marbles that thousands of slaves dug, worked and transported to these mountains. Apr 12, 2019· The word "Carrara" itself is made of the Celtic "kair" or its Ligurian form "kar," both meaning "stone".The double consonant R is likely to come from the French "Carrière" (quarry). Due to its antiquity and production size, Carrara is a perfect case study for anyone who wants to study the evolution of the marble extraction techniques throughout the ages.

Carrara, Nevada and Carrara, Italy have something in common. They are producers of marble. In 1911 prospectors found deposits and the American Carrara Marble Company was formed. The quarry was located in the mountains and the townsite about three miles away on the flat valley next to the Las Vegas and Tonopah Railroad.

Carrara (/ k ə ˈ r ɑːr ə / kə-RAR-ə, Italian: [karˈraːra]; Emilian: Carara) is a city and comune in Tuscany, in central Italy, of the province of Massa and Carrara, and notable for the white or blue-grey marble quarried there. It is on the Carrione River, some 100 kilometres (62 mi) west-northwest of Florence.Its motto is Fortitudo mea in rota (Latin: "My strength is in the wheel").

The Civic Museum of Marble, founded in 1982 by the Municipality of Carrara, is home to the city's history, where the culture of marble is preserved and promoted not only through its rich permanent collection, but also with conferences, temporary exhibitions and sculpture symposiums.

VISITING THE MARBLE QUARRIES The first stage in a visit to the marble quarries of Carrara generally begins at Colonnata, an ancient fortified village at a height of 532 m above sea level, which according to tradition was founded by the Romans to house the slaves they employed in the quarries.
This site dates back to the 4th century BC C and has white marble deposits and rudimentary cover case composed of recycled materials; among them, precisely, marble fragments. The mining activity was developed by the Romans, especially under Julius Caesar (48-44 BC).

Carrara is world-famous for its white marble, pure and without veining. You just need to look up and see the uncovered mountains of the Apuan Alps: it's there the origin of statues, monuments and buildings. Michelangelo itself used to go up to the Altissimo mountain (1589 meters) to take the marble to sculpt and create its works.
Carrara marble has been used since the time of Ancient Rome and it was called the "Luni marble". In the 17th and 18th centuries, the marble quarries were monitored by the Cybo and Malaspina families who ruled over Massa and Carrara. The family created the "Office of Marble" in 1564 to regulate the marble mining industry.

Carrara marble tiles are a classic white marble with a mixed fleuri and vein cut that blend to create subtle yet distinctive patterns. The veining in white Carrara marble is mainly gray with a light to white background, but Carrara can also have a slight gold tint to its veining that provides added dimension.

The Vermont Danby quarry is the largest underground marble quarry in the world. The quarry is entered through the same opening that has been in use for over 100 years. From the outside of Dorset Mountain the quarry looks the same as it did a century ago. From there the quarry twists and turns 1 ½ miles deep where Danby Marble is quarried.
